On 21 September 2015, XPAX introduce FREE Internet Burung Hantu which provide FREE "Unlimited" High Speed Internet from 1 am to 7 am daily. There's a cap, you must subscribe to Monthly or weekly Internet plan to enjoy this benefit.  In t&c of XPAX Burung Hantu haven't mention anything about maximum quota capped and just some kind of unlimited speed and quota. On the other hand, they stated there's a cap of quota in some of the website.

Refer to malaysianwireless.com
"When asked about the Free Unlimited high speed Internet, Zalman Aefendy Zainal Abidin, Chief Marketing and Sales Officer of Celcom Axiata Berhad told MalaysianWireless that the free unlimited high speed Internet has a monthly usage cap per user, however the cap is “more than enough” for customers. "

SoyaCincau
"There apparently is also fair usage policy in regards to the data but Celcom claims that the limit is “big enough to literally surf unlimited”. This is on top of their 500MB free basic internet per month which you get as long as your subscription is active."

Theoretically, Celcom 4G LTE speed is around 10-50mbps, we can download up to 100 GB in this 6 hours time per day. If really get unlimited data per day, we can download as much as possible. I bought a Magic SIM and subscribe to monthly Internet, I will do testing for maximum download. Let's figure out tonight.

user posted image
Update:
Some user downloaded 50 GB last night without quota cap
It's unlimited data now

Update 2
After downloaded 100GB, internet speed become slow
